The singers were absolutely superb and the orchestra was great. The AI was a catastrophe. The Greek chorus that stared at the audience for the entire performance was unsettling and distracting. The at times random AI, that mixed paintings, animation, real life video and out of sync singing, along with the performers was truly a distraction. There are many more things to criticize, but the mixed epoch’s also was a distraction. While I won’t go so far as to say there is no role of AI in opera, this was not it. A really well crafted CGI approach with live actors interacting in that kind of set would’ve seemed more appropriate. The performers and Orchestra truly...

Symphony Hall is a nice venue. The opera singers for Aida were wonderful. The orchestra is fantastic. Adding the worst cartoon/AI movie/video game as a background to the singers and Orchestra was the worst and funniest thing I've seen on a long time. It was absolutely a terrible idea but thanks for the laugh during a tragedy. Seriously, we couldn't stop giggling. Please don't do that again. Too stupid and an insult to the talent of the performers. We, as well as many, many others, made our escape at...
